Publisher's Synopsis

This book offers a collection of works by Johann Wolfgang von Goethe, one of the most important German writers of the 18th and 19th centuries. With a focus on his plays and shorter works, the book offers insights into Goethe's versatile talents and wide-ranging interests, from classical drama to contemporary social satire. With numerous beautiful translations and helpful notes, this book is an essential resource for anyone interested in German literature.
